Ruifang District
Ruifang District is a suburban district in eastern New Taipei City in northern Republic of China (Taiwan). Mining was an important industry in Ruifang in the early 20th century. Gold was mined in Jiufen (九份) and Jinguashi (金瓜石) while coal was mined in Houtong (猴硐). The mining sites became popular tourist destinations after 1990. Area: 70.73 km² Population: 41,690 people (Sep, 2012) In March 2012, it was named one of the Top 10 Small Tourist Towns by the Tourism Bureau of Taiwan.
Keelung Islet
Keelung Islet is a small island located 3.35 km northeast of the northern shore of Keelung, Taiwan and 4.9 km away from the Port of Keelung. It has an area of 23.91 ha . It is 910 m in length, and 410 m in width including the artificial harbor, the highest point is 182 m above sea level. In ancient times, the island was seen as a sacred place by locals. It was rumoured that a female ghost named Shih-Yun lived there, to mourn over her husband who died in a shipwreck hundreds of years ago.
Port of Keelung
The Port of Keelung, also refers to Keelung Harbor, located in the vicinity of Keelung City, Taiwan. It is operated by Taiwan International Ports Corporation, the Taiwan's only state-owned harbor management company.
Keelung Station
Keelung Station is a terminus of the Taiwan Railway Administration (TRA) Western Line and Eastern Line in Keelung City, Taiwan.
